Olympus targets 5% camera sales increase this year
By Jack Wong KUCHING: Olympus (M) Sdn Bhd, which has launched a new range of digital compact cameras with unique features, targets to increase camera sales by 5% to 600,000 pieces for the fiscal year ending March 31, 2007. Its managing director Tan Tick Boon said the company hoped to boost sales revenue to at least RM90mil during the same period, up from RM82mil last year. He was confident that this could be achieved with the introduction of more attractive camera models, anticipated better retail sales during the Chinese New Year period and Visit Malaysia Year 2007. Tan said despite the stiff competition of the digital camera industry, Olympus had recorded a remarkable performance last year, with its market share growing 7% to 20%. Now ranked among the top three brands in Malaysia, Olympus is eyeing an expanding market share to 30%. "To help meet our new sales targets, we have allocated 7% of our revenue for advertising and promtion efforts this year, covering a multitude of mediums, like billboards, television commercials, print and on-line advwrtisements,'' he added at the launch of three Olympus lastest digital compact models at the Kuching Hilton on Thursday. The new models - SP-550UZ, u 770 SW and the all new 7.1 megapixel u 760 - will be unveiled in peninsula Malaysia later. http://biz.thestar.com.my/news/story.asp?f...12&sec=business Added on February 11, 2007, 9:44 pmsomeone bought for 1.8k with 1gb xd card... I just bought the SP550-UZ. It's my first high-end camera (well, high end compared to my previous camera which is the Sony U60 waterproof 2MP camera). I was really attracted to the styling and the following :
1. 18x optical zoom with image stabilization 2. rubberised grip 3. Uses AA battery (convenient to reload when travelling) 4. Great specs like the 30fps video clip and the super macro (1cm) Been having it for around 5 days now. I must say the 18x optical zoom is really useful. Coupled with the image stabilization, taking shots at max zoom without a tripod is much easier.
